20 hooded teenagers attack canal boat owners in Failsworth

A gang of 18 teenage thugs terrorised the owners of two canal boats by hurling stones and jumping on their barges to try and stop them going through a lock.

The boaters were attempting to navigate a lock on the Rochdale Canal in Failsworth, Oldham, when the hooded youths approached them.

The gang of teens jumped up and down on the boats, hopping between the two crafts, as the worried owners tried to move on.

The victims have shared video footage of the incident, which took place at 3pm on Monday, in the hope of catching those responsible.

One of the five-strong boat crew, who asked not to be named, said: ‘My wife and I had cycled ahead of the party to approach the lock for the boats to come down.

‘When the two boats came down they started jumping onto the boats and rocking them.

‘It was really dangerous, if they had got crushed between the boat and the wall they could have got seriously injured or killed.

‘When the boats came down they put their hoods over their faces.’

Another member of the crew said: ‘We live in those boats. It’s our house. Imagine someone coming in and jumping on your house and in your garden.

‘Nothing like this has ever happened to us before. But it’s our first time on the Rochdale Canal – it has this terrible reputation.

‘People don’t like stopping on it. Just before that incident this group of girls were shouting at us further up the canal, and one started spitting in our direction.’

The group of boys are described as being between the ages of 12 to 14, and were wearing hoodies and tracksuit bottoms.

No arrests have been made and police are appealing to anyone with more information to get in touch.

A GMP spokeswoman said: ‘We were called to reports a group of about 18 youths around 14-years-old were jumping on canal boats and throwing stones at the boats.

‘No arrests have been made.’

Anyone with further information can contact police on 101, quoting reference 1115 of September 5.
